Cashier’s checks are, in a sense, “pre-paid” by the person who gets the check. After receiving the funds to cover the amount of the check and any additional fees, the bank will then write a check out of its own money with a specified designated payee. It’s then guaranteed directly by the bank or credit union.

The funds are usually then available to the ...What To Write on the Voided Check. The employee should write VOID over the date line, payee line, amount box, amount line, and signature line. Ideally, this should be done in blue or black pen. There is no need to complete any of the fields on the check. After voiding the check, it’s helpful to record the voided check number in the check ...

Writing “VOID” across the front of the check prevents anybody from using the check to make a standard check payment (by filling in a payee and an amount). ... Step 4: Write out the amount in words. Step 5: Say what it's for. Step 6: Sign your name....Step 4: Write the payment amount in words. On the line below “Pay to the order of,” write out the dollar amount in words to match the numerical dollar amount you wrote in the box. For example, if you are paying $130.45, you will write “one hundred thirty and 45/100.”. To write a check with cents, be sure to put the cents amount over 100.Mar 15, 2023 · Step 2: Personal information.
